Above The Sky Chapter 1368

Raising his head, Ian no longer stared at the gap of Star Prison Tianyu. Instead, he turned around to look in the direction of Tera Star, where Terra was located. "I still have a choice now— but another me, you’ve already failed. Humans no longer have the right to choose. You only have five years. What will you do to face this apocalypse?" He murmured softly, with a latent anticipation and curiosity in the eyes of the youth watched by the anxious gaze of Galewind Dragon King, a feeling more terrifying than madness: "Even if all life in this universe doesn’t believe in you, I will believe in you." "Because if it’s me, there would absolutely be a way." The white-haired youth gazed at the distant, flickering sun on the other side of space-time behind him, with brilliance surpassing a thousand suns roaring up and flowing past. Five light-years away, five years in time, this is humanity’s last chance. Ian soared, following the light stream that destroyed all things forward, heading towards the sun and Terra, while Galewind Dragon King suppressed its immensely shocked emotions and set off with him. The youth sat on the Dragon King’s back, traveling alongside the light that destroys everything. Time flowed swiftly under the gaze of the Prophet. Soon, five years passed in an instant. Patiently waiting, Ian felt something in his heart and looked ahead. Terra was already in sight. But strangely, on the Terra Planet, there were no traces of life or signs of biological activity. The cities had long turned to ruins, the nation had no vitality... even the forests had completely vanished, the entire continent and ocean seemed to have been completely sifted through by some incredible monster, devoured entirely, leaving not even a trace of insects. This once prosperous human homeland had become a silent Dead Domain. Yet Ian raised his eyebrows, showing a look of delight. "This is how it should be! Thousand-Star Beast, the Spark of Thousand Stars, I knew I could do it!" Looking up, Ian gazed at the distant sun, his eyes carrying a madness that made the Galewind Dragon King feel a chill: "Next, it’s your turn!" In the Prophet’s perspective that transcended time and space, he and the Dragon King saw at this moment. Saw the destruction of the sun. Accompanied by the enormous gravitational disturbance that began to distort the entire star, one after another, colossal coronal mass ejections burst forth, licking the surrounding cosmic space-time, erupting with super-gigantic star gas structures beyond human imagination — now, the sun looked from afar like a super-gigantic octopus with countless tentacles, where each tentacle was enough to effortlessly pick up a planet and play with it as if it were a marble. But soon, these tentacles and erupting stellar material began to contract. Contract towards the core within. The collapse had begun. Due to the suddenly emerged strong gravitational phenomenon, the outer layers of stellar material began collapsing towards the core interior, these vast stellar materials being pulled to collide with their own core, in the most terrifying fusion reactions, heavy elements heavier than iron began to form, and unbelievable energies erupted out, mixed with the reactive forces from the collision of stellar outer materials against the core, roaring out in all directions! This is a supernova eruption! In the instant Terra’s sun collapsed for unknown reasons and began a supernova eruption, it released energy several hundred times greater than the total energy it had previously emitted, endless light and stellar material turning into an overwhelming flood, rushing out at light speed! And just at this moment. Accompanied by Ian’s maniacal laughter and Galewind Dragon King’s lost roars, they saw what was concealed in this light - the ’behemoth’! It was a spaceship fully transformed into light, a beast thoroughly merged with light! A dragon as big as the Moon just like that spread its wings in the supernova’s eruption, flying along the momentum of endless flood towards the outside world! That was the dragon— Light Dragon! Already phototransformed, accelerated to light speed in the time period after the supernova eruption, flying alongside the erupting streams of light and stellar material, maintaining relative speed— the Light Dragon needed not to counter the unstoppable stellar eruption behind itself but instead utilized this force to ride the waves, maintaining almost eternal ’phototransformation’ and ’light-speed navigation’! And the force from the collapse of Tera Star causing the supernova eruption instantly swallowed the residual waves of the ’supernova eruption’ leaking from the gap of Star Prison Tianyu! Yes, perhaps the supernova light leaking from the gap originated from a star larger than Terra Sun, its energy being more massive... but it had traveled through endless space-time, experienced a long stretch of time. Thus, in front of a newly erupting supernova, its light was instantly devoured, dissolved. And the Light Dragon roared, following the path of light, dashing towards the gap of Star Prison Tianyu, which was the final exit! The light of Terra Sun almost eternally enveloped it, ’today’s sun’ will never set, ’yesterday’s brilliance’ will always be left behind. This ship eternally maintaining light speed, this one bearing the supernova eruption force to counter another supernova— this ’Generation Ship,’ the Ark of Light, would travel to ’tomorrow’ carrying the souls of all humans, all Terra’s creatures! Such an ending is the chosen path of the Dao by another Ian in the endless future. Its name is ’Solitary Dragon’, also ’Ark’, and furthermore, ’tomorrow’— to reach tomorrow, to welcome the future; to see the brilliant Galaxy, bathed in the light of stars, even the sun nurturing all beings can be utterly destroyed, transformed into the propulsion to reach afar... [—Star Extinguishment Path—] At this moment, Ian was almost unable to see this Light Dragon... but could still barely see some remnants. Even though the core part was constructed by Ian, just like how the previous Mechanical Dragon was controlled by all crew members together, Ian of Extinguished Stars could not maintain such an enormous dragon’s phototransformation alone. This gave the current Ian room to continue observing. —It can fly out! It definitely can fly out! —Regardless of the outcome, whether hope or despair, this time, it will definitely fly out! The golden-hued brilliance flashed, the Light Dragon roared, aimed at the inner side of Star Prison Tianyu, towards the final gap— It passed through the aperture. Like passing through countless spaces-times. The still existing but sparse sky full of stars shone. Light Dragon arrived outside of Star Prison Tianyu! At this moment, Ian wanted to shout out loud. He saw despair and found hope again. Even though, through the process, indeed he did many unbelievable and exceptionally excessive things, the final result was good! Yet he didn’t make a sound. The white-haired youth seemed to fall into an ice cave. Because the light surging from the inner side of Star Prison Tianyu by the Terra Star did not continue to spread further. Leading the Light Dragon out of Star Prison Tianyu, the light suddenly got blocked after flowing for a while. That was... pitch-black, surging, indescribable unfathomable... impossible to describe using any language... The light halted here. For the Prophet saw the End. The pitch-black End that crawled between stars diffusing in the surrounding space-time, it discovered nothing, sensed nothing could perceive neither stars nor Cradle seemed to exist, unable to catch even the slightest attention. It appears in this world, it alone is the only real existence, the entirety of matter painfully unable to tilt even a shred of vision. Indeed it was , unexplainable, unimaginable, difficult to describe and ponder existence, hence named The End — The End of stars, the center of civilization, the end of reason, the end of logic.
